HUAIBIBI.COM
All Inbound Redirects

No inbound domain redirects found yet.

HUAIBIBI.COM
Outbound Redirects
DomainCountryFirst DetectedLast Detected
x xihuantv.com 2021-01-17 2021-01-17
1493 days ago
b bxx222.com 2022-07-05 2022-07-05
959 days ago